Scisum’s support pole is a heavy-duty alloy steel accessory designed to protect clubs within travel bags. It’s adjustable from 27 to 56 inches and can be installed quickly without tools, thanks to a simple push-button mechanism. The pole helps prevent club heads from bending or colliding during transit, offering an extra layer of protection alongside the bag’s own padding.

While not a standalone suitcase, this accessory is valuable for travelers seeking enhanced rigidity inside their golf travel setup. Its rugged construction and ease of setup make it a practical addition to a protective travel system.

Buying Guide

  • Protection level: Prioritize hard-shell tops or reinforced interiors to prevent club damage from impact and pressure.
  • Fit and capacity: Check universal sizing and club-head allowances to ensure your set fits with room for shoes and accessories.
  • Mobility: Look for smooth-rolling inline skate wheels and multiple carry options (top handles, side handles, and shoulder straps).
  • Closure security: Durable zippers and buckles minimize movement and keep clubs in place during transit.
  • Accessibility: A full-open design or wide openings aids faster packing and unloading, reducing handling time at airports.
  • Weight balance: Ultra-light or lightweight designs reduce fatigue on long trips while still protecting clubs.
  • Add-ons: Optional accessories like a protective pole or strap systems can enhance protection for frequent travelers.

When comparing options, assess total protection versus weight, and consider whether you need a hard-case top, a soft-sided body, or a hybrid design. For frequent travelers, a model with durable wheels and multiple carrying methods often provides the best balance of protection and convenience. If you travel with sensitive clubs or valuable equipment, extra padding and reinforced closures are worthwhile considerations. Finally, verify that the bag complies with airline sizing policies to minimize in-cabin adjustments.
